I have noticed a lump inside my vagina, towards the'top'wall (if you're sitting down). Sometimes it is lower, and sometimes its like it shrinks further up. Since noticing this lump, it is almost as if there is less room in my bowels - when I need to go to the toilet, my stools make the vaginal wall lumpy, and crowds the inside of my vagina, so there is less room in the vagina. I'm worried about this because although I am a virgin, I would like to sleep with my boyfriend, but I'm afraid he will realise there is something wrong.

Men are pretty clueless, you shouldn't worry that he will notice. You should, however, worry that you have an unexplained lump in your vagina. Seeing a doctor will help enormously, and will relieve your mind, and you should also ask the doctor about birth control and preventing STDs before you have sex for the first time.Oh, and yes, stools make the vaginal wall lumpy anyway: you're feeling the stool through the wall. You should get the lump checked out anyway if it's there when there is no stool present.
